Diff for /freem/doc/freem.texi between versions 1.26 and 1.27

version 1.26, 2025/04/18 03:59:29 version 1.27, 2025/04/18 15:39:23
Line 1938  Identical to @ref{$TRANSLATE()}, except Line 1938  Identical to @ref{$TRANSLATE()}, except
 * WITH::                                Set prefix for future variable references.  * WITH::                                Set prefix for future variable references.
 * WRITE::                               Write output to current input/output device.  * WRITE::                               Write output to current input/output device.
 * XECUTE::                              Interpret string as M code.  * XECUTE::                              Interpret string as M code.
 * ZALLOCATE::                           Alternative to @code{LOCK}.  
 * ZBREAK::                              Unknown.  * ZBREAK::                              Unknown.
 * ZDEALLOCATE::                         Alternative to @code{LOCK}.  
 * ZGO::                                 Unknown.  * ZGO::                                 Unknown.
 * ZHALT::                               Unknown.  * ZHALT::                               Unknown.
 * ZINSERT::                             Insert code into routine buffer.  * ZINSERT::                             Insert code into routine buffer.
Line 3866  Returns or sets the maximum number of ch Line 3864  Returns or sets the maximum number of ch
 Returns or sets the maximum number of characters of a single global subscript, from 1-255.  Returns or sets the maximum number of characters of a single global subscript, from 1-255.
   
 @item @code{SINGLE_USER} +R +U -D  @item @code{SINGLE_USER} +R +U -D
 If set to @code{1}, FreeM will skip all file locking operations on globals, as well as the @code{LOCK} and @code{ZALLOCATE} tables. If set to @code{0}, FreeM will enforce file locking on both.  If set to @code{1}, FreeM will skip all file locking operations on globals. If set to @code{0}, FreeM will enforce file locking on both.
   
 Setting @code{SINGLE_USER} to @code{1} will improve FreeM performance, but you must @emph{ONLY} use this on systems where you are absolutely sure that only one FreeM process will run at any given time, as running multiple instances of FreeM concurrently when any of them are set to @code{SINGLE_USER} mode @emph{will} cause global data and @code{LOCK}/@code{ZALLOCATE} table corruption!  Setting @code{SINGLE_USER} to @code{1} will improve FreeM performance, but you must @emph{ONLY} use this on systems where you are absolutely sure that only one FreeM process will run at any given time, as running multiple instances of FreeM concurrently when any of them are set to @code{SINGLE_USER} mode @emph{will} cause global data corruption.
   
 @item @code{CHARACTER} +R -U -D  @item @code{CHARACTER} +R -U -D
 Returns the character set of the job.  Returns the character set of the job.
Line 5840  The FreeM @code{LOCK} table. Line 5838  The FreeM @code{LOCK} table.
   
 Supported actions are @code{list} and @code{remove}.  Supported actions are @code{list} and @code{remove}.
   
 @item zallocate  
 The FreeM @code{ZALLOCATE} table.  
   
 No actions yet implemented.  
   
 @item journal  @item journal
 FreeM after-image journaling.  FreeM after-image journaling.
   

Removed from v.1.26  
changed lines
  Added in v.1.27


F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>